ECE 5256 Project 2
Intensity Transformations
You can use any images for the following, but the project works best if the images are of poor contrast (too dark, too bright, mostly gray...).
Compare two approaches to Histogram Equalization
Part 1
a) display an image
b) plot its histogram
c) display the histogram-equalized image
d) plot the histogram-equalized image histogram
Part 2
Repeat the steps in Part 1 but with a different approach to histogram equalization.
Equalize the histogram of each 77 region of an image separately. For images with sizes that are not a multiple of seven, simply extend the image with the same value as the last row or column.
Part 3?
Compare the results of the two approaches. Which method produces a more accurate histogram equalization (flat histogram)?
